GEO
The old El Paso Weaver T-25 is 19 1/4" long, it weighs 1 Lb. 4 ounces, it comes with a 1/4 min. dot and fine cross hair it is also 1/4 min. adjustment at 100 yds. for Elevation and Windage.
If you do happen to find one, make sure you get a chance to look thru it, they were notorious for building up some kind of mold between the two front lenses. Mine has been repaired twice in 20 years, last time just before the repair station in El Paso close for good, that was several years ago. The mold is back on it again. It won't hurt the function of the scope, but whatever you look at is very cloudy, nowhere as clear as when cleaned.
